Network coding allows eavesdropping on non-source, non-destination wireless nodes in order to recombine overheard data with its own data, which increases the ability of the ultimate destination to recover a high amount of information, even in the case of high bit error rates. Coordinated multi-channel communication has the potential to dramatically increase the throughput for many types of LLN applications. My work seeks to unify network coding and coordinated multi-channel communication.
